BlackRock Faces Redemption Surge in Private Credit Fund, Heightening Investor Concerns
BlackRock, a titan in the asset management industry, grapples with significant challenges as outflows from one of its private credit funds reach record levels. The firm implements restrictions on redemptions after witnessing nearly 9.3% of the fund's net asset value being withdrawn, prompting a broader reassessment of confidence in private credit as an investment strategy. This surge in withdrawals signals growing unease among investors regarding market stability, as private credit, which had previously attracted significant interest due to its yields, now faces scrutiny over its liquidity and risk management practices.
The current landscape presents a critical turning point for BlackRock and the private credit sector at large. Recent market uncertainty, driven by geopolitical tensions, notably the military conflict in the Middle East, exacerbates investor anxiety. Analysts note that this environment could dampen appeal for alternative assets often viewed as less predictable, such as private credit funds. With major firms in the industry experiencing similar withdrawal pressures, concerns mount that the recent trends may indicate a systemic risk within the burgeoning private credit market.
Moreover, financial analysts emphasize that BlackRock's situation reflects broader shifts in investor sentiment, indicating a cautious outlook for the asset class moving forward. As the firm navigates these operational challenges, the future strategies it adopts will be critical in restoring investor confidence. Without a clear response to mitigate the mounting pressures faced, BlackRock's position as a leader in the investment arena may come under scrutiny, impacting not just its fund flows but also its reputation within a highly competitive marketplace.
